Therapeutic effect involves the consequences of any medical treatment. The results of the therapeutic effect are usually seen to be beneficial and also desirable to the patient.The Nursing and Midwifery Council (NMC) code of conduct is responsible for ensuring acceptable performance, ethics and conduct for professional nurses and midwives. Nursing is a profession found in the health care sector. It deals with care on people, families and communities so as to maintain, recover or attain tonicity health and quality life. Nurses are responsible for developing plans for health care, working in teams with therapists, physicians, the patients family, the patient, and other staffs in the team (Chin, 2008).
